Placement Experience:

From the seventh semester, we are eligible for Campus placements. Exxon Mobil, SLB, TCS and many companies with a decent amount. The Highest package is 33 lpa and the average package is 5 lpa. The percentage of students getting placement is 100%. My plans after getting the degree are to join the job and work for a few years.

Remarks:

We have to achieve at least 75% in the 10th standard examination and above 65% in the 12th standard examination. All the relevant details regarding the academic information can be found on the official website of the college.

Placement Experience:

The students can sit in placements from 3rd year itself but mostly do in 4th year... The average packages of most branches are not that great and go for 5lack per annum to 8 lahks... However, CSE placements average from 12 lakhs per annum to 15 lakhs and can go up to 50 lakhs. 80 to 90 per cent of students get placed the rest are however removed at the beginning of the process. My plans for after the degree are undecided currently.

Remarks:

There was no entrance test... admission was given on basis of the 12th cbse percentage and jee mains percentile. I was given a girl's scholarship which reduces 20% fees per sem. There could be a better admission process.

Course Curriculum Overview:

Course I choose because of the great opportunity in future 1 faculty assigned to 20 student Faculty are highly qualified with international degrees and mostly are PhDs. In one semester here are two-term exams

Remarks:

It was based on two patterns either JEE scores or Entrance. I went through the entrance process. It was moderate, where they checked English, maths, and science-based questions. After that, I got counselling in Delhi, where I got admission. Eligibility: 55% min in 12th Application fee: 1200INR
